Finance Managers in Sydney earn a median salary of $160,000 in 2026, with most advertised roles falling between $125,000 and $199,000. That sits 68% above Sydney's all-roles median of $95,000. Figures are based on 72 jobs advertised on Seek.com.au in Sydney in the last 30 days.

Understanding the Sydney Market

Finance manager hiring in Sydney climbed from 51 to 72 listings this month, a strong demand rise, while the $160,000 median held flat. That figure runs 68% above the city's $95k all-roles median and splits by seniority: $155k at mid-level, $185k for seniors. Sydney leads the role nationally, ahead of Melbourne ($150k) and Brisbane ($147,500). Rising demand plus a steady, high median makes this one of the most reliably well-paid roles in the batch.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a good starting salary for a junior Finance Manager in Sydney?
Finance manager is not an entry role, and there is no junior band. The path in is from a qualified Accountant ($100k in Sydney) or Financial Accountant ($125k) background, with a CA or CPA, then stepping up to own a finance function. Early in the mid band (which starts near $121k), pay climbs by taking on budgeting, board reporting, and team management rather than pure technical accounting.
Is $160,000 a good salary in Sydney?
Yes, strongly. At $160k the median earns 68% above Sydney's all-roles median and nets roughly $112,500 after tax, enough to carry a mortgage in the middle-ring suburbs even in an expensive city. For a role reachable through the standard accounting ladder, this is top-tier pay. The prerequisite is a CA or CPA plus genuine leadership scope, not just senior technical work.
How much does a Senior Finance Manager make in Sydney?
Senior finance managers in Sydney earn a median of $185k, with the band reaching $220k. Getting there means owning a larger function or a commercial-partnering remit, and often the next title is Financial Controller or Head of Finance. Managing a team, driving forecasting and strategy, and partnering with the executive on decisions are what lift pay into the senior band, alongside the CA or CPA.
